Google has been working on a wearable device for a long time. A few days back we have got to know about a petition from Google that mentions the name of the wearable as Pixel Watch. It was obvious for everyone as Google is looking to form a ecosystem with Pixel as their brand name. Now we get a leak at the real life pictures of a person wearing a Pixel Watch.

A user from Reddit with username “u/tagtech414” has leaked pictures of the upcoming Google Pixel Watch. The watch contains a silicon band in black color matching with the watch color. The screen of the Pixel Watch seems to be bezel less that has been in works for most of the competitors. The Watch seems to be 40mm with a thickness of 14mm and a weight of 36 grams.

The user mentions on how comfortable the watch was as it seemed as he wore nothing. He also adds that the digital crown that seems to be pointed out doesn’t even poke when he is bending or typing. The Pixel Watch was a pain to attach for the first time as it was little unclear of how to attach. But the watch seems to be pretty solid after attaching it to the hand. The band is made of silicon and doesn’t even leave fingerprints or oil marks too much that is a great thing.
